What is an Online License?
An online license is a legal arrangement that allows a private or company to use an item or service, typically governed by particular terms and conditions. Unlike traditional licenses, which may include paper agreements or physical documents, online licenses are usually released and managed digitally. They can cover a broad variety of items, including:
Software applicationsDigital media (music, videos, eBooks)Online coursesExpert certificationsMemberships for various services
Online Licence licenses can vary significantly in scope and terms, influencing how services or products can be utilized.
Types of Online Licenses
Online licenses can be classified into several types, each serving various purposes:

Subscription Licenses:
Users pay a repeating fee to access software or services. Common in cloud-based software applications.
Continuous Licenses:
A one-time purchase fee grants users indefinite access to an item, although updates might require additional payments.
Trial Licenses:
Temporary licenses allowing users to evaluate an item for a minimal time before committing to a purchase.
Freemium Licenses:
Basic gain access to is offered totally free, however enhanced functions require payment.
Website Licenses:
Allow numerous users within a specified organization or area to access the item.
Open Source Licenses:
Enable users to utilize, customize, and distribute software application freely while adhering to specified conditions.The Importance of Online Licenses
Online licenses play an essential function in various aspects of digital life. Here are some of the advantages they supply:

Legal Protection: Online licenses protect the intellectual home rights of developers, making sure that they can manage the circulation and usage of their work.

User Rights: Licenses clarify what users can and can not do with an item, minimizing confusion and potential abuse.

Profits Generation: For organizations, online licenses are a revenue stream, allowing them to continue innovating and improving their offerings.

Access Control: Organizations can manage who has access to their service or products, which is especially crucial for software application or educational content.
How to Obtain an Online License
Obtaining an online license typically involves a simple process. Below is a basic summary of the steps included:

Research: Identify the product or service that requires a license. Understand the different types of licenses offered and select the one that fits your needs.

Select a Vendor: Choose a reputable supplier or company known for their licensing offerings.

Review Terms: Before purchasing, thoroughly read the licensing contract and regards to service to guarantee understanding of constraints and responsibilities.

Purchase: Complete the purchase procedure by providing payment and any essential details.

Access the Product: After the transaction is finished, you will usually receive a confirmation email with guidelines on how to access your service or product.

Compliance: Always abide by the terms of your license, consisting of use restrictions and renewal guidelines, to avoid legal issues.
Challenges and Considerations
While online licenses provide many advantages, there are obstacles and considerations to keep in mind:

Terms and Conditions Complexity: Many users struggle with the intricacy and length of online licensing agreements, which may cause unintentional offenses.

Regional Restrictions: Some licenses are subject to local constraints, restricting gain access to based upon geographical area.

Revocation of License: Violation of the terms can cause the cancellation of access, potentially interfering with usage of critical tools or resources.

Information Privacy: Licensing arrangements typically consist of stipulations relating to information collection and use, which users should scrutinize thoroughly.
FAQs About Online Licenses
What should I do if I lose my online license secret?
Contact the product's customer service or assistance team. They may have the ability to verify your purchase and provide a replacement key.
Can I move my online license to another user?
This depends on the particular regards to your license. Some licenses are non-transferable, while others may enable transfers under specific conditions.
What happens if I breach my license arrangement?
Violating your license arrangement might result in cancellation of access to the product, fines, or even legal action taken versus you by the license holder.
Are free online licenses dependable?
Free licenses might differ in reliability. It is essential to understand the terms and confirm the credibility of the service provider before dedicating.
Is a digital signature enough to validate an online license?
In lots of cases, a digital signature can verify an online license. Nevertheless, make sure that the signing authority is genuine and that the terms are compliant with regional laws.
